A composite site is a relatively new approach to creating web resources that combines the best aspects of traditional sites and modern technologies. This type of site consists of many components and modules that allow you to quickly and conveniently manage content, as well as adapt to the changing needs of users and businesses. In this article, we will consider the main characteristics of composite sites, their advantages and disadvantages, as well as situations when their use is appropriate.
What is a composite site?
A composite site is a web resource that is built on the basis of various modules and components that allow the creation of dynamic content. Instead of using static pages, composite sites are built on dynamic elements that can be loaded shopify website design upon user request. This makes it possible to create more interactive and adaptive web pages, where each element can be individually created and customized.
A composite site can be based on a variety of software and tools, such as CMS (content management systems), frameworks, and libraries. For example, components can include widgets, forms, interactive maps, and other elements that can be easily integrated and customized to meet specific needs.
Advantages of Composite Sites
- Flexibility and Scalability: Composite sites allow you to quickly add and change components without having to completely reload the site. This makes them ideal for fast-changing businesses and organizations that need to adapt to new conditions.
- Simplified Content Management: With the modular structure, users can manage different elements of the site separately. This greatly simplifies the process of updating content and avoids errors that can occur when editing static pages.
- Improved User Interfaces: Composite sites can offer a more interactive and responsive interface. For example, users can interact with elements that load dynamically, increasing engagement and improving the user experience.
- SEO Optimized: Such sites are easier to optimize for search engines as they can provide consistent and relevant content, which has a positive impact on search engine rankings.

Disadvantages of Composite Sites
- Complexity of development and maintenance: Creating a composite site requires more skills and resources than creating a traditional site. This can increase the time and cost of development.
- Technology Dependency: Composite sites often rely on third-party libraries and APIs, which can create vulnerabilities and dependencies on the stability of these technologies.
- Caching Challenges: The dynamic nature of content can make caching processes more difficult, which can impact site performance.
When to use a composite site?
Composite sites are suitable for many different situations. They can be especially useful for large companies with a diverse range of products, news portals, educational institutions, and organizations that update content regularly.
If your business requires a high level of interactivity, fast information updates and scalability, a composite site may be the optimal solution. By choosing this approach, you get the opportunity to create a modern and user-friendly web resource that can adapt to changing conditions and the requirements of your customers.
Conclusion
A composite site is a powerful tool for modern businesses and organizations that want to stay on the cutting edge of technology and meet the needs of their users. Understanding the basic principles of creating and managing such sites will allow you to effectively use them in your work, increasing customer satisfaction and optimizing business processes. If you want to create a site that will adapt, grow and develop along with your business, then a composite site may be a particularly relevant option for you.